Description
"A Rill from the Town Pump" by Nathaniel Hawthorne is a story set in a town where the Town Pump serves as a central figure, narrating its experiences and interactions with the townspeople. The Town Pump reflects on its historical significance, from providing water to Native Americans to symbolizing temperance and purity. Through humor and social commentary, the story explores the Town Pump's perspective on human behavior and the potential for positive change through simple acts of kindness and moderation.
